The stuff of great fiction here: princesses, kings, harems,
palace intrigue, treason, murder, wrongful imprisonment, struggle beyond
understandable human endurance, strong relationships, escape, capture,
resolution, and hope. Elements of a great story (and a compelling book),
however, aren’t necessarily experiences I would wish on actual people, and
certainly not in relation to this particular story. This is an autobiography.
